Summary
In 2011, Foo Fighters embarked on the Garage Tour in support of their album Wasting Light.
The band played concerts in the garages of eight lucky fans across North America, who had entered a competition.
One of the winners was Canadian superfan Nick Perry, who welcomed the Foo Fighters to his farm in Milton, Ontario - around 40km from Toronto.
Nick talks to Foos Files about the surreal experience - from thinking it was a prank by his friends to performing several songs with the band.
